Blue Guitar is a 31.33 m Motor Yacht, built in the United Kingdom by Camper & Nicholsons and delivered in 1965.

Her top speed is 12.0 kn and her cruising speed is 10.5 kn and her power comes from two Gardner diesel engines. She can accommodate up to 7 guests in 3 staterooms, with 5 crew members waiting on their every need. She has a gross tonnage of 130.0 GT and a 5.3 m beam.

She was designed by Camper & Nicholsons, who also completed the naval architecture. Camper & Nicholsons has designed 29 yachts and created the naval architecture for 27 yachts for yachts above 24 metres.

Blue Guitar is one of 2183 motor yachts in the 30-35m size range.

Blue Guitar is currently sailing under the United Kingdom flag, the 4th most popular flag state for superyachts with a total of 932 yachts registered. She is known to be an active superyacht and has most recently been spotted cruising near the United States of America.
